So early on I got creative, I began making my own --preservative free, home cooked microwavable meals. I figure if Lean Cuisine can do it, why can't I?
So I do--its simple and anyone can do it. I make larger portions of most dinners, portion off the leftovers, put them in Tupperware and stack them in the freezer. On any given day I have anywhere between 2 and 6 options for Dave to take to work. Think of the endless possibilities....Stouffer's does....
